Yarok Feed Your Ends Leave In Conditioner | Review

Yarok Feed Your Ends Leave In ConditionerI’ve seen this Yarok leave-in conditioner recommended on a few blogs, so this product isn’t new to me. Yarok is natural, vegan, and gluten-free hair care brand, which also cares for the environment. It donates 3% of its annual profits to The Pachamama Alliance, a non-profit organization protecting rainforests in the Amazon.

Yarok Feed Your Ends Leave-In Conditioner (travel size, 59ml)
The conditioner came with the Petit Vour September Beauty Box. I don’t know why I expected it to be cream instead of liquid, maybe because my last leave-ins (John Masters detanglers) had cream consistency. However, this one is as watery and runny as it gets. It’s a combination of vitamin water, grapeseed oil, jojoba oil, apricot oil, and evening primrose oil. The conditioner not only nourishes your hair but also prevents the damage from heat styling. I use a blow-dryer and a hair straightener often, so heat protection is crucial for me. The scent is herbal, fresh, and reminds me of citrus mixed with rosemary. It absorbs quickly and doesn’t make my hair heavy, but I would love more hydration.

See the ingredients:

Vitamin Water, Jojoba Oil, Olive Oil, Grapeseed Oil, Apricot Oil, Evening Primrose Oil, Fatty Acids, Plant-sourced Xanthan Gum, Potassium Sorbate, Essential Oils of Rosemary, Litsea Cubeba.
